Honeywell 900G01‑0001 Contact Input Module – 16-Channel DI for ControlEdge HC900

Description

The Honeywell 900G01‑0001 is a 16-channel digital contact input module designed specifically for the Honeywell ControlEdge HC900 hybrid controller platform . This high-density discrete interface efficiently acquires dry contact signals from field devices such as pushbuttons, limit switches, and auxiliary relay contacts, converting their on/off states into logic signals for the CPU . The Honeywell 900G01‑0001 features galvanic isolation between field wiring and the system backplane, protecting sensitive control electronics from electrical surges and ground loops while ensuring reliable operation in demanding industrial environments

Parameters

Main Parameters Value/Description
Product Model 900G01‑0001
Manufacturer Honeywell
Product Category Digital Contact Input Module
Input Channels 16 independent dry contact inputs
Input Type Dry contact / discrete contact closure
Logic High (ON) 10 VDC to 30 VDC
Logic Low (OFF) 0 VDC to 3 VDC
Input Impedance 10 kΩ typical per channel
Switching Current 2.6 mA nominal; 3.1 mA max per channel
Max Contact Resistance 1000 Ω
Response Time OFF→ON 4 ms maximum
Response Time ON→OFF 6 ms maximum
Backplane Loading 130 mA @ 5VDC max; 40 mA @ 24VDC max
Isolation Type Galvanic isolation (field-to-logic)
Operating Temperature 0°C to 60°C
Dimensions (H×W×D) 137 × 35.6 × 151.7 mm
Weight 0.354 kg
Mounting HC900 I/O rack or 35mm DIN rail

 

Technical Principles and Innovative Values

The Honeywell 900G01‑0001 operates on a robust architecture centered on signal integrity and system protection. Each input channel continuously monitors the resistance state of an external contact, detecting the transition from open to closed (or vice versa) and transmitting the resulting logic state to the HC900 controller via the rack backplane . The module’s self-powered design provides the necessary sensing voltage internally, eliminating the need for external power sources for dry contact detection .

Innovation Point 1: Integrated Hardware Debounce and Noise Filtering. The Honeywell 900G01‑0001 incorporates advanced debounce logic and hardware filtering directly at the input stage . This eliminates false state transitions caused by mechanical contact bounce during switch actuation and suppresses electromagnetic interference from nearby high-voltage equipment. The result is clean, reliable digital signals without requiring additional software filtering in the controller program.

Innovation Point 2: Galvanic Isolation for System Protection. The Honeywell 900G01‑0001 provides galvanic isolation between the field wiring (input side) and the module’s microcontroller/backplane circuitry . This barrier prevents electrical surges, ground loops, and high-voltage transients from propagating to the sensitive HC900 controller electronics, safeguarding the entire control system investment .

Innovation Point 3: Hot-Swap Capability and High-Density Design. The Honeywell 900G01‑0001 supports module replacement while the rack remains powered, enabling maintenance without process interruption . Its compact 35.6mm-wide form factor allows high-density mounting in the HC900 I/O rack, maximizing valuable cabinet space for large-scale automation projects with hundreds of discrete field points .
